An American Indian reservation visited by President Bill Clinton during a July "poverty tour" erupted in unrest Sunday as dissidents alleging financial malfeasance took over the tribal government complex.

More than 100 people were involved in the peaceful takeover of the Oglala Sioux Tribal headquarters on the Pine Ridge Indian Reservation in South Dakota, traditional leader Dale Looks Twice told 7amNews. He said that those involved in the takeover are asking for a federal audit of millions of dollars in tribal monies that"never reached the people."

Elected officials have been "cashing in on our people," Looks Twice declared. He pointed out that the Pine Ridge Reservation has more than 80 per cent unemployment and "for the last 20 years has been the poorest county" in the U.S.

FBI officials removed records and computers relating to programs administered by the tribal housing program, Looks Twice said. That investigation has been ongoing for months, he noted.

The occupation will continue until all issues are resolved, he said. Among them: demands for the the restoration of lands known as the Buffalo Gap grasslands and the removal of the tribal treasurer, as well as a review of the tribe's constitution and other documents.

Clinton visited the reservation in July as part of his anti-poverty initative. At that time, he promoted an increase in HUD and Fannie Mae housing programs. Ironically, it is those programs that now are among those being investigated for possible improper financial dealings. Also under fire: the handling of a $7.8 million program for law enforcement, which, despite funding, on Friday laid off 60 tribal law enforcement workers.

PINE RIDGE, S.D. (AP) -- About 100 Oglala Sioux who accuse the tribe of financial mismanagement have taken over tribal headquarters and demanded that the governing council step down.

The group, which is allied with tribal President Harold Dean Salway, took control of the tribal building at the Pine Ridge Reservation on Sunday. About 100 people stayed there overnight and said they will remain until they are satisfied authorities will investigate their allegations.

Members of the tribal council voted to have the protesters thrown out of the building. They voted to have tribal law officers enforce tribal laws that ban the spread of false propaganda and actions that interfere with the conduct of council business.

Council members said they expect the tribe's public safety director to evict the protesters Monday night or Tuesday.

Members of the unarmed group are calling for an audit and have demanded the immediate resignation of tribal Treasurer Wesley "Chuck'' Jacobs and all 17 members of the tribal council. They also have asked the FBI to seize tribal records dealing with law enforcement, housing and other programs.

"The bottom line is, we want accountability and responsibility by our elected officials,'' said group spokesman Dale Looks Twice.

On Sunday, federal agents used to a search warrant to seize paper files and computer records from the Oglala Sioux Housing Authority. U.S. Attorney Ted McBride said the warrant was related to an investigation of programs funded by the Department of Housing and Urban Development.

By Monday evening, Salway, the tribal president, signed an order suspending Jacobs for a second time. He suspended Jacobs in October for allegedly mismanaging tribal funds, but a tribal judge later reinstated the treasurer.

And the council adopted resolutions encouraging a tribal judge to hold Salway in contempt for violating previous court orders that said he did not have authority to fire Jacobs.

Jacobs said there has been no mismanagement of federal or tribal funds and told council members they need to make sure financial records are not destroyed.

"This thing is a total breakdown in tribal government. It's up to you guys to regain control,'' Jacobs said.

Eileen Janis, a spokeswoman for Salway, said the president and others have become frustrated with Jacobs and the council majority that always supports the treasurer. "We want a complete audit of everything,'' she said.

Mark Vukelich, senior supervisory agent with the FBI in Rapid City, said Monday afternoon that the protesters have not provided specific allegations.

Most of the tribe's 12,100 members live on the reservation, which consistently ranks as one of the poorest areas of the nation.

The Bureau of Indian Affairs: A Legacy of Mistrust

This week's Fleecing of America broadcast segment is about financial trouble at the U.S. Bureau of Indian Affairs. Auditors are saying they can't locate $2.4 billion of the bureau's transactions and that individual accounts totaling $450 million are also in jeopardy.

The BIA holds money in trust for individuals and tribes whose properties are leased to private entities such as mining and ranching corporations. For about 100 years, the BIA has been receiving these funds and passing them on to Indian owners. The problem in this case is that the bureau has lost track of its records, jeopardizing the finances of Indian families and entire tribes.

The scandal over the missing records has prompted a class action suit against the Treasury Department and the Department of the Interior, which oversees the BIA. Indians filing the suit in conjunction with the Native American Rights Fund blame the problems on shoddy record-keeping and the lack of an audit trail in the BIA system.

The whole affair adds up to a fleece of major proportions, affecting hundreds of tribes and hundreds of thousands of individual Indians. It also affects tax payers, of course, who are financing this mismanagement now and might have to pay millions to resolve it later.

This week's online feature: The flap at the BIA is one in a long line of failed government initiatives relating to Indians that dates back to the beginning of the republic. Our multimedia timeline, "The Bureau of Indian Affairs: Legacy of Mistrust," shows that from the time of the Continental Congress, Indian policy has been complicated by contradictions and reversals, and compromised by cynicism, mismanagement and outright lies.

Self Determination late 1960's - 1980's

In the 1960s, a small but vocal group of Indian activists began trying to change the bureaucracy that was responsible for hundreds of years of broken treaties and failed policies. Members of this new Indian movement (sometimes called Red Power) preached a message of greater self-determination, tribal self-government and increased Indian involvement in the political process. In terms of policy, activists were seeking a return to the time of the Indian New Deal, when John Collier had first introduced the concept of government-sanctioned tribal sovereignty and self-determination. But this time around, it was members of militant activist groups who were demanding the changes. In sometimes violent protests, groups such as the American Indian Movement began demanding an overhaul of the BIA. Saying that the bureau did not represent the interests of Indians, activists occupied the BIAs Washington headquarters in 1972. In another famous incident a year later, AIM activists led an armed standoff with federal agents on the Sioux tribes Pine Ridge reservation at Wounded Knee. Partly as a result of these struggles, the government passed a wide range of new legislation to help empower Indians -- all of which was administered through the BIA.

Today

One of the legacies of the Indian activism of the past 20 years is the increasing role of Indians in the administration of their own affairs. Now, for example, the staff of the Bureau of Indian Affairs is about 90 percent Indian. And though many of the highest posts within the BIA are still held by non-Indians, the most powerful position within the bureau is held by Ada Deer of the Menominee tribe in Wisconsin.

Another legacy of the struggle for Indian self-determination is a growing prosperity among some tribes --particularly those that have taken advantage of the federal Indian Gaming Regulatory Act. Passed in 1988, the legislation legalized casino-style gambling on Indian reservations, in some cases generating profits that would have been inconceivable to tribal ancestors. Its notable that the BIA has administrative responsibility for this legislation, but has little if anything to do with the new-found wealth of the most successful tribes, since the legislation holds the tribes directly responsible for the administration of their own gaming operations. Indeed, many point to Indian gaming operations as a truly successful example of policy which places power directly in the hands of Indians instead of bureaucrats.

But questions about the viability of the BIA persist. The bureau still administers programs that dont seem to make a dent in the poverty and declining employment rates that continue to place certain tribes among the poorest segments of the U.S. population. And, of course, the bureaus trustee relationship with many of the nations tribes has become an issue again. According to its own literature, the BIA cannot precisely define the nature of its trustee relationship with certain tribes. "The trust agreement is not written out in any document." But according to the BIA, "it is an established legal and moral obligation to protect and enhance the property and resources of Indian tribes." The latest flap over lost funds seems to contradict this statement.
